Warung Makan Dik Bagong is a delightful seafood restaurant nestled in the heart of Pantai Depok, Parangtritis, within the scenic Bantul region of Yogyakarta. This humble yet inviting eatery captures the essence of coastal culinary charm, offering a truly authentic Indonesian seafood experience that’s both memorable and wallet-friendly.
As you step into the warung, the atmosphere instantly feels relaxed and welcoming, with simple seating arrangements including traditional lesehan—perfect for savoring your meal while enjoying a cool sea breeze. The rustic setting fits perfectly with the fresh catch served on your plate, creating a harmonious dining experience that connects you directly to the local fishing culture.
The menu proudly features an impressive variety of fresh seafood, where diners can handpick their preferred fish, squid, or shellfish before choosing how it’s cooked. Signature dishes like the perfectly grilled fish “bakar” are an absolute must-try—its smoky, tender flesh bursting with natural flavors, enhanced by your choice of sauces such as oyster, buttery, or the delightfully tangy and spicy asam pedas (sour and spicy). The crispy fried squid (“cumi crispy”) adds a wonderful contrast in texture, elevating the meal with its golden crunch and savory seasoning.
One of the standout highlights from diners’ reviews is the incredible freshness of the seafood, paired with the flexibility to customize each dish to your taste, from traditional spicy sambals to rich, flavorful sauces. The sambal varieties—including terasi (shrimp paste), kecap (sweet soy), and sambal tomat—offer vibrant layers of heat and depth, making every bite exciting. Customers also appreciate the affordable prices and a fair cooking fee rate of Rp 20,000 per kilogram, making it accessible without compromising quality.
The attentive and friendly service enhances the overall experience, guiding you through choices and even offering free picnic mats if you’d like to enjoy your meal right at the beachside.
